摘要
The article presents the results of signal analysis of the recorded singing voice samples. For that study the recorded samples of the "a-e-i-o-u" exercise is analysed. Some significant parameters describing voice have been estimated. Among the estimated parameters are: pitch, calculated with the use of autocorrelation method, values of the first five harmonics, set of parameters containing first five formants and the value of vibrato parameter. The analysis of those parameters allowed, among others, to draw conclusions about dependencies of their values for different sung vowels. The study is a part of a broader research on singing voice signal analysis. The results may contribute to the development of the diagnostics tools for computer analysis of singer's and speaker's voices. The authors try to find an answer to the question whether the dependencies observed between the parameters may be useful to evaluate the quality of singing. This may be useful when designing a computer based singing assessment systems.
